I've been using the binary installation of Guix on Debian 8 for some time now. However, after a "guix pull", I can't install packages anymore.


Steps to reproduce
===============

  1. Run "guix pull" as a user
  2. Run "guix package -i guile"


Expected result
============

The latest stable version of GNU Guile is installed correctly.


Unexpected result
==============

I get the following error:

warning: failed to install locale: Invalid argument

System information
===============

Guix (after pull): guix (GNU Guix) 20170216.20

Foreign distro:
Debian 8 (Linux makina 3.16.0-4-686-pae #1 SMP Debian 3.16.39-1 (2016-12-30) i686 GNU/Linux)


Additional notes
=============

There is a related conversation about this problem in #guix log (https://gnunet.org/bot/log/guix/2017-02-17#T1295254) where amz3` reported the same problem on Ubuntu 16.10 (amd64). lfam couldn't reproduce the problem on x86_64 Guix on Debian.

It was suggested by lfam in the same conversation that the problem might be due to a very old guix-daemon, which is true for my system. However, there was no way for me to update the daemon because I get the same error described above when I run the second step of the following procedure (run as root):

  1. Run "guix pull"
  2. Run "guix package --upgrade"
  3. Restart guix-daemon
